Output 53134d7480589f0626403fc5ffbcdb80b239fe6693af7295faedf1dc4cb8aa4c:279

value
12265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 756ff397c5e7587124ed79789d910373cbd9149b OP_EQUAL
address
3CPy6Ww85oKaYTiC6PZrTCpDducevU3mB5
transaction
53134d7480589f0626403fc5ffbcdb80b239fe6693af7295faedf1dc4cb8aa4c
spent
true